    If keratin is part of the body, then why does it become an irritant and infectious?

    • @DrMudgil
      @DrMudgil  2 года назад +3

      Great question! Keratin is supposed to "live" in a hair follicle, in a nail, or on the surface of the skin. When it escapes into the skin the body considers it a foreign body of sorts.

    Is there anything you can do at that point?
    Also, does size matter? If this does happen, how likely is it to enflame and need to see a doctor? It's not guaranteed, is it?

    • @DrMudgil
      @DrMudgil  2 года назад

      When a ruptured cyst is acutely inflamed, it can be drained, treated with intralesional steroids, and sometimes antibiotics too. You should definitely check in with a board certified dermatologist in such a situation. 😉
